Renowned entrepreneur and CEO of Tesla and SpaceX, Elon Musk, has taken legal action against four unidentified individuals for allegedly scraping data from his Twitter account. The lawsuit, filed in a California court, sheds light on the growing concern surrounding data privacy and unauthorized use of social media information.

The complaint accuses the unnamed defendants of engaging in the unauthorized extraction and collection of data from Elon Musk’s Twitter profile. Scraping, a technique used to extract data from websites, involves automated processes that bypass the site’s intended means of data access. In this case, the individuals allegedly scraped data from Musk’s Twitter account without his consent or knowledge.

Musk’s Twitter account, known for its unfiltered and sometimes controversial posts, has amassed a significant following, making it a valuable source of information and insight into his business ventures and personal life. The lawsuit argues that the scraping of this data violates Musk’s rights to privacy and control over his own online presence.

The defendants’ motives for scraping Musk’s Twitter data remain unknown, as they have not been identified. However, such information can potentially be used for various purposes, including analyzing market sentiment, tracking public sentiment towards Musk and his companies, or even attempting to manipulate stock prices.

In recent years, concerns over data privacy and the unauthorized use of personal information have gained increased attention. This case involving a high-profile figure like Elon Musk brings these issues into the spotlight once again, prompting discussions about the ethical and legal boundaries of data scraping.

Legal experts speculate that if the defendants are identified and the allegations are proven true, they could face significant consequences, including financial penalties. Furthermore, this lawsuit could set a precedent for future cases involving the scraping of personal data from social media platforms.

Elon Musk has not publicly commented on the lawsuit, and it remains to be seen how the legal proceedings will unfold. The case highlights the importance of safeguarding personal data and raises questions about the responsibility of individuals and companies to protect their online presence from unauthorized data collection.

As the legal battle progresses, it will undoubtedly generate interest from both privacy advocates and technology enthusiasts. The outcome of this lawsuit could have far-reaching implications for data privacy and the boundaries of online data collection, influencing future practices and regulations in this rapidly evolving digital landscape.
